Founded in 2008, Legends is a global premium experiences company that specializes in delivering holistic solutions for sports and entertainment. With six divisions operating worldwide, Legends offers a 360-degree service solution platform that includes Global Planning, Global Sales, Hospitality, Global Partnerships, Global Merchandise, and Legends IQ. The company works with marquee clients across various sectors, including professional sports, collegiate, attractions, entertainment, and conventions, to design and realize exceptional experiences.

  • Legends Global will manage day-to-day operations at Huntington Bank Field and its new enclosed stadium, including event booking, facility maintenance, and vendor management, as announced by Haslam Sports Group President David Jenkins and Legends Global President Josh Kritzler.
  • Legends Global will serve as Owner's Representative for the University of Nebraska's "Big Red Rebuild" of Memorial Stadium, a fan-first renovation approved by the Board of Regents.
  • Legends Global partnered with the New York Yankees to introduce new food and drink options at Yankee Stadium for the 2026 season.
